Quote:Committed to ECU since June, Webb has drawn offers after a breakout senior season with McEachern (Ga.) High School from the likes of Michigan, Tennessee, Louisville, South Carolina, Ole Miss, Houston, UCF, Kentucky and more. But the three-star prospect has stayed committed to the Pirates this entire time, and he will now return for his second game day visit of the year, and his fourth overall trip to Greenville.
Webb visited twice in June, picking up his first offer from East Carolina, and returning for his official visit later in the month, and committing to head coach Mike Houston. The Georgia native also visited for the South Carolina game inside Dowdy-Ficklen Stadium on Sept. 11.
In between that time and his return visit to ECU, Webb has also taken official visits to Louisville and Michigan, and game day trips to South Carolina and Tennessee. Webb has told 247Sports he's thinking about taking an official visit to Tennessee in early December. In the mean time, Webb's return trip to Greenville will be an important one to once again reunite with the ECU coaching staff and players on the team, all of whom Webb has a strong bond with.

Cincinnati lands a nice commit from 6'4, 285 lb 3-star IOL Evan Tengesdahl who is currently ranked as the #17 prospect in the state of Ohio 2023 class. Cincinnati already has commits from 4 of the top 20 players in Ohio for 2023. Evan projects as either a guard or center at the D1 level. Really nice pick-up!
